Easy to dismantle

Transporting a mobility device in the vehicle can be extremely difficult for Arlen Nizo many. The difficulty is in knowing how to dismantle the scooter, then reassemble it without causing damage. It is a good idea for you to familiarise with the instructions given by the manufacturer of your scooter prior to loading it into your car boot. This will simplify the process.

There are a variety of different mobility scooters with 4 mph speeds that fold or disassemble to make this task simpler. Some scooters come with batteries that are removable which makes them easy to carry or load into your car.

The best way to pack your scooter into the car's boot is to put the rear part first, then the front section. This will protect your car boot from damage and aiding in keeping the weight spread across the scooter. After that, you can add the seat and battery pack before completing the front basket. It is important to keep a blanket in the back of your boot as this will prevent the paintwork of your car from getting scratched.

Easy to assemble

A car boot-scooter can be a mobility device that can be easily assembled in the boot of your car. This makes it simpler to travel and take the scooter with you whether it's to the market or for an extended vacation.

Our car boot scooters are comprised of five major parts that can be lifted and put together in just a few seconds. They are small enough for a car boot or van.

The Freerider Luggie, for example, is one of the lightest and smallest models that can be folded to fit into the back of the car or in the boot of a car. This means that a family member or friend can easily lift the scooter into the car, and then get it out when they want to use it.

It's a simple process to load a scooter in the vehicle. It will save time and energy for the driver. Some of these models come with an area for storage in which you can store your spare batteries and other accessories for use when you're out.

Another option that is popular is a folding ramp which can be pulled out and folded up when not in use, thereby saving space in your car. This is particularly useful for tall mobility scooter, as it allows you to fit it in the boot at the right angle.

If a ramp doesn't fit your needs, Arlen Nizo consider using a hoist. This allows you to lift a wheelchair or scooter in the trunk of your vehicle with a click of a button. Hoists are easy to set up and do not require permanent modifications, which means they are able to be used on many vehicles at the same time.
